How much do data entry data analyst j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for data entry data analyst in Tulsa, OK is $30.07,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.33 and $33.61 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a data entry data analyst?

Data Entry Data Analysts are professionals who combine the responsibilities of data entry and data analysis. They collect, organize, and input large volumes of data into databases or spreadsheets, ensuring accuracy and consistency. In addition to managing data, they use analytical tools to interpret and analyze information, generate reports, and help organizations make data-driven decisions. This role requires strong attention to detail, proficiency in data management software, and analytical thinking sk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a data entry data analyst?

To thrive as a Data Entry Data Analyst, you need strong attention to detail, accuracy, and foundational data analysis skills, typically backed by a degree in a related field such as business, statistics, or computer science. Familiarity with spreadsheet software (such as Microsoft Excel), database management systems, and data visualization tools like Tableau or Power BI is often required. Excellent organizational skills,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ication help you manage large data sets and convey findings clearly. These skills are crucial to ensure data integrity, support decision-making, and drive organizational efficiency.

How do data entry data analysts typically collaborate with other departments to ensure data accuracy and consistency?

Data Entry Data Analysts often work closely with teams such as finance, operations, and IT to verify data sources and resolve discrepancies. This collaboration usually involves regular meetings, cross-checking data against departmental records, and clarifying data requirements with stakeholders. Effective communication and attention to detail are essential, as these analysts must ensure that data is both accurate and consistent across various systems and reports. Building strong relationships with colleagues in other departments also helps streamline data validation processes and supports organizational goals.

What is the difference between Data Entry Data Analyst vs Data Analyst?

AspectData Entry Data AnalystData Analyst
Required SkillsBasic data entry, Excel, attention to detailData interpretation, statistical analysis, advanced Excel or SQL
Work EnvironmentData entry teams, administrative settingsBusiness, finance, marketing departments
CertificationsNone or basic Excel certificationsData analysis certifications (e.g., Microsoft Excel Expert)

The main difference is that Data Entry Data Analysts focus on inputting and maintaining data accuracy, while Data Analysts interpret data to provide insights. Data Entry Data Analysts typically perform repetitive tasks with less emphasis on analysis, whereas Data Analysts require analytical skills and tools to interpret data trends and support decision-making.

Can I be a data entry data analyst with no experience?

Data entry data analyst roles often require basic computer skills and familiarity with spreadsheets or data management tools. While prior experience can be helpful, entry-level positions may be available for candidates willing to learn and develop relevant skills through online courses or certifications.

Your Job
Koch Engineered Solutions (KES) in Wichita, KS, is seeking a curious and driven Business Data Analyst to join our Information Technology (IT) team in Wichita, KS or Tulsa, OK. In this role, you'll work with business and IT partners to turn data into meaningful insights, dashboards, and reporting that support operational and strategic decisions across our Equipment, Technology, and Services (ET&S) business. You'll gain hands-on experience solving business problems, improving data quality, and helping drive profitable transformation. Visa sponsorship is not available.
Our Team
The Data & Information Technology team is collaboratively focused on transforming business data into trusted, actionable information that enables effective decisions across Koch Engineered Solutions. Our team brings together data analysts, business data specialists, and data governance to partner closely with stakeholders to improve data quality, streamline decision making, and support digital transformation initiatives. We thrive on solving complex business challenges, driving continuous improvement, and creating practical solutions that help our organization work smarter. Above all, we value teamwork, curiosity, and commitment to delivering reliable data that drives long-term business value.
What You Will Do
  • Partner with stakeholders to identify opportunities and develop data-driven solutions that create long-term business value.
  • Apply business acumen, analytical thinking, and technology capabilities to identify opportunities that drive innovation and competitive advantage.
  • Translate complex business challenges into scalable data, analytics, and technology solutions that enable better decision-making and outcomes.
  • Collaborate across business and technical teams to design solutions that improve performance, unlock value, and advance strategic objectives.
  • Work closely with solutions delivery leads, data engineers, developers, architects, analysts, product owners, and IT partners throughout the delivery lifecycle.
  • Support solution design, validation, testing, deployment, change management, and continuous improvement activities.
  • Serve as a trusted advisor, connecting people, processes, data, and technology to create lasting value.

Who You Are (Basic Qualifications)
  • Professional or educational experience working with data and analytics
  • Experience presenting data, analysis, or recommendations through coursework, internships, projects, or professional experience
  • Experience working with data in Excel (formulas, pivot tables, data manipulation)
  • Demonstrated problem-solving and analytical skills

What Will Put You Ahead
  • Bachelor's degree in Business, Analytics, Data Science, Information Systems, or a related field
  • Experience using GenAI to create work efficiencies
  • Exposure to data visualization tools such as Power BI, Tableau, or similar platforms
  • Understanding of business concepts or business operations
  • Familiarity with SQL, Python, or other analytics tools
  • Demonstrated economic thinking or ability to connect analysis to business value
  • Experience with project management, Agile concepts, or cross-functional project work
